Scientists ’ve uncovered a intriguing aspect of how our brain works: the almost immediate process of premotor decision-making. Before we knowingly register a intention to act – say, reaching for a drink or stepping aside – a network of brain zones rapidly determines the appropriate motor sequence . This "quick yes," a subconscious signal stemming in premotor cortexes , initiates the body for action often even we're fully conscious of the selection . Investigations suggest that this system helps us deal with the surroundings with remarkable efficiency and fluidity .

Why Your Brain Says "Yes" Before Conscious Thought

Ever find yourself nodding to something before you’ve truly evaluated what’s being said ? It’s not a failure ; it’s a illustration of how your brain operates . Neuroscientists have revealed that a significant portion of our decision-making happens on an automatic level, well before our conscious minds become aware the information . This is largely due to the brain’s remarkable ability to quickly evaluate situations based on past experiences and habits, often triggering a near-instantaneous, instinctive “yes” – a rapid response that prioritizes speed over analysis. This "fast thinking," as called by Daniel Kahneman, allows us to navigate a demanding world efficiently, but it can also produce biases and regrettable choices.

Decision-Making Psychology: The Subconscious "Yes"

Our decisions aren't always guided by aware thought. Research into choices reveals a fascinating phenomenon: the subconscious "yes." This notion suggests that people often unknowingly commit to actions simply by being exposed to them. It's associated with the “mere-exposure effect,” where repeated familiarity with a stimulus increases its appeal . Consider examples like product placement in films or repeated messaging – they subtly plant a "yes" in our minds before we even know we're evaluating it. This mechanism has profound implications for marketing and understanding people’s actions .

A Science regarding Instant Consensus : Why Your Brain Gives Yes

Ever questioned why particular people seem to frequently get individuals to concur so easily? It’s not just charm or charisma; there's genuine research behind it. Our brains are wired with seek patterns and shortcuts, and a technique known as mirroring – unconsciously copying body language and speech patterns – triggers a feeling like connection and rapport . This subconscious matching fosters trust, making listeners more prepared to support your viewpoints. Furthermore, the principle of reciprocity – the ingrained need to reciprocate favors – plays a significant role; when someone feels understood, they’re more likely to react in kind. It’s a complex interplay of neurological processes that leads to that seemingly effortless "yes."
